About the artist

Steven Patrick Morrissey, known simply as Morrissey, first rose to fame as the lead singer of The Smiths. With his distinctive, theatrical voice and razor-sharp lyrics-infused with romance, cynicism, and humor-he managed in just five years and four albums to leave behind a significant legacy.

In March 1988, he released Viva Hate, marking the beginning of his solo career. A series of albums followed, including Your Arsenal (1992) and Vauxhall and I (1994). In the early 2000s, he made a triumphant return with You Are The Quarry (2004), which met with great success and proved that Morrissey remained one of the most intriguing figures in the alternative scene. Ringleader of the Tormentors (2006) confirmed his enduring presence, while Years of Refusal (2009), World Peace Is None of Your Business (2014), and Low in High School (2017) found him exploring new expressive directions.
